O50LFA integrates spectrum, illuminance, color temperature, color rendering index, flicker, flicker index Pst, flicker effect visibility SVM, R9, wavelength, irradiance, chromaticity coordinates, color tolerance and other measurement parameters in one. Using 5-inch large screen, all parameters and curves displayed in real time, easy to use. Can measure LED and other wide/narrow spectrum light sources, full spectrum eye-protection desk lamps, classroom lighting and other products, compliant with IEEE Std1789, CIE SVM, IEC Pst ASSIST flicker parameter evaluation.

The HP-350BF Spectrum Flicker Illuminance Meter (Flicker Version) adds flicker measurement function on the basis of the Essential version, specifically for measuring flicker, flicker index, flicker percentage of light sources and lighting sites, compliant with IEEEStd1789-2015 standard. Blue light hazard weighted irradiance (mW/m²), Maximum allowable exposure time (S), Hazard level (retinal blue light hazard parameters). Blue light hazard weighted irradiance calculation method complies with EN62471, GB/T 20145-2006 standards for blue light hazard small light source hazard assessment. Meets requirements of new GB 7000.1 for blue light hazard measurement. Mainly designed for children's eye-protection desk lamps, primary and secondary school campus lighting inspection for blue light hazard and flicker hazard inspection and evaluation.
